Transaction 37eed5009d7a6e470bb004b97fc462d6903444674105ec75d6fa1980faa90f31
1 Input
2 Outputs
- 37eed5009d7a6e470bb004b97fc462d6903444674105ec75d6fa1980faa90f31:0
- 37eed5009d7a6e470bb004b97fc462d6903444674105ec75d6fa1980faa90f31:1
value 900000
address 1Fw8FUfqorLSkkDVXbB16m4z1xVzXCNZ1u
value 1027340
address 33nydb6Gqse4V5NDeqR9h5mAgZpRb2idjh